5. Insert the jack mount (item 6) into the
receiver. Two sets of mounting holes are
provided on the jack mount; see Figures 5 and
6 to determine the appropriate mounting hole.
Once the hole is aligned with the receiver,
secure with the clevis pin (item 7) and hairpin
(item 5).
Figure 5
1. Installed on unit with counter weight(s)
Figure 6
1. Installed on unit without counter weight(s)
6. Reinstall the front floor pan assembly and
UltraVac counter weights if so equipped.

Using the Jack Kit
The jack kit raises the front end of the mower to
allow you to clean under the mower deck and
change the blades.
WARNING
The mower could fall onto someone and
cause serious injury or death.
ORead and understand the operator’s
manual before performing maintenance.
OAlways turn the engine off, set the
parking brake and remove the key
before performing any maintenance to
the mower.
ODo Not keep the mower raised on the
jack for extended periods of time.
OAlways use a jack on a level surface.
OEnsure the jack is secured properly to
the mount using the jack pin.
OThis jack is intended for use with the
mower as described in this instruction
sheet. Other uses may cause unseen
damage or failure of the jack.
ODo Not rely solely on the jack for
support. Use adequate jack stands or
equivalent support.
ODo Not mount or dismount the mower
while the jack is raised.
OPrior to each use, inspect jack and
mount kit for proper working function
and no visible signs of damage.
1. Only use the Exmark approved jack(s) rated at
2,000 lbs or higher lift capacity with Exmark
jack mount.
2. Stop the engine, wait for all moving parts to
stop, and remove key. Engage parking brake.
3. Raise the mower deck to the transport
position.
4. Insert the jack tube onto the jack mount, align
the mounting holes, and secure with the jack
pin (see Figure 7).
